TB-RNA、TB-DNA、基因芯片技术检测BALF对儿童涂阴肺结核的早期诊断价值  被引量:4

摘  要:目的评估结核菌核糖核酸(tuberculosis bacterium ribonucleic acid,TB-RNA)、结核菌脱氧核糖核酸(tuberculosis bacterium deoxyribonucleic acid,TB-DNA)、基因芯片技术检测支气管肺泡灌洗液(bronchoalveolar lavage fluid,BALF)对儿童涂阴肺结核的早期诊断价值。方法收集2019年1月至2022年8月于福建省福州肺科医院住院的227例0~17岁疑似涂阴肺结核患儿的BALF,进行TB-RNA、TB-DNA、基因芯片检测,分析三种检测方法的诊断效能。结果诊断为肺结核168例,非肺结核59例。以临床综合诊断(composite reference standard,CRS)为金标准,三种方法单独检测及联合检测BALF的敏感度分别为40.48%、39.29%、38.69%、56.55%,特异度分别为98.31%、96.61%、100%、94.92%,曲线下面积(Area under the curve,AUC)分别为0.694、0.679、0.693、0.757,单独检测的敏感度与培养法(44.64%)比较,差异均无统计学意义(χ^(2)分别为1.24,1.73,2.53,P均>0.05),联合检测的敏感度高于培养法及单独检测,差异均有统计学意义(χ^(2)分别为9.52,25.04,27.03,28.03,P均<0.05);三种方法检测的敏感度BALF明显高于痰,差异均有统计学意义(χ^(2)分别为41.33,24.92,28.17,P均<0.05)。以培养结果阳性为金标准,BALF进行三种方法单独检测及联合检测的敏感度分别为76.00%、69.33%、72%、85.33%,特异度分别为98.31%、96.61%、100%、94.92%,阳性预测值(Positive predictive value,PPV)分别为98.28%、96.30%、100%、95.52%,阴性预测值(Negative predictive value,NPV)分别为76.32%、71.25%、73.75%、83.58%,Kappa值分别为0.72、0.64、0.69、0.79,AUC分别为0.872、0.830、0.860、0.901。结论TB-RNA、TB-DNA、基因芯片检测BALF可快速诊断涂阴肺结核,联合检测可以提高儿童涂阴肺结核的病原学诊断率。Objective To evaluate the early diagnostic value of detection of bronchoalveolar lavage fluid(BALF)by tuberculosis bacterium ribonucleic acid(TB-RNA),tuberculosis bacterium deoxyribonucleic acid(TB-DNA),and gene chip technology for smear-negative pulmonary tuberculosis in children.Methods From January 2019 to August 2022,227 children aged 0 to 17 years old with suspected negative smear pulmonary tuberculosis were collected from Fuzhou Pulmonary Hospital in Fujian Province,and TB-RNA,TB-DNA and gene chip detection were performed to analyze the diagnostic efficiency of the three detection methods.Results There were 168 cases of pulmonary tuberculosis and 59 cases of non-pulmonary tuberculosis.Using composite reference standard(CRS)as the gold standard,the sensitivity of BALF detected by three methods alone and in combination was 40.48%,39.29%,38.69%and 56.55%,respectively.the specificity was 98.31%,96.61%,100%and 94.92%,and the Area under the curve(AUC)was 0.694,0.679,0.693 and 0.757,respectively.The sensitivity of single detection was compared with that of culture method(44.64%).There was no significant difference(χ^(2):1.24,1.73,2.53,P>0.05),and the sensitivity of combined detection was higher than that of culture method and single detection,with statistical significance(χ^(2):9.52,25.04,27.03,28.03,P<0.05).The sensitivity of BALF detected by the three methods was significantly higher than that of sputum,and the difference was statistically significant(χ^(2):41.33,24.92,28.17,P<0.05).With positive culture results as the gold standard,the sensitivity and specificity of BALF were 76.00%,69.33%,72%,and 85.33%,respectively,and 98.31%,96.61%,100%,and 94.92%,respectively.Positive predictive value(PPV)was 98.28%,96.30%,100%,and 95.52%,respectively.Negative predictive value(NPV)was 76.32%,71.25%,73.75%,83.58%,and Kappa value was 0.72,0.64,0.69,0.79,respectively.AUC was 0.872,0.830,0.860,and 0.901,respectively.Conclusion The detection of BALF using TB-RNA,TB-DNA and gene chip can quickly diagnose smear-negative pulmona
